Manager, Direct Procurement
- Lead, mentor, and develop a team of Buyers responsible for procurement execution across direct material commodities.
- Drive operational excellence across purchase order execution, supplier communications, material availability, and procurement processes.
- Establish clear priorities, workload balancing, and accountability across the Buyer organization.
- Ensure timely and accurate purchase order creation, revisions, confirmations, and supplier follow-up activities.
- Monitor supplier delivery performance and proactively drive recovery plans for shortages, late deliveries, and supply disruptions.
- Partner closely with Global Supply Managers (GSMs) to ensure sourcing strategies are successfully executed through procurement.
- Work cross-functionally with Planning, Engineering, Manufacturing, Finance, and Supply Chain Program Management to ensure material readiness for engineering builds and production.
- Lead daily and weekly procurement execution reviews, ensuring timely resolution of supplier issues and procurement bottlenecks.
- Drive procurement process standardization and continuous improvement across purchasing workflows.
- Partner with Procurement Operations to improve enterprise resource planning (ERP) and material requirements planning (MRP) data integrity, procurement reporting, and operational efficiency.
- Ensure procurement master data including pricing, lead times, supplier records, and purchasing parameters remain accurate and well governed.
- Support new product introduction (NPI) by ensuring procurement readiness for prototype, validation, and production builds.
- Develop and monitor procurement key performance indicators (KPIs) including supplier delivery performance, purchase order cycle time, shortage resolution, procurement responsiveness, and buyer productivity.
- Serve as the primary escalation point for procurement execution issues and supplier delivery challenges.
- Collaborate with Finance to support invoice resolution, procurement reporting, and operational planning.
- Foster a culture of ownership, urgency, accountability, and continuous improvement across the procurement team.
- Bachelor's degree in Supply Chain Management, Business, Engineering, or practical equivalent experience.
- 8+ years of progressive experience in procurement, purchasing, or supply chain within hardware, robotics, automotive, aerospace, or advanced manufacturing environments.
- 3+ years of experience leading or mentoring procurement or purchasing teams.
- Strong understanding of direct material procurement including mechanical, electrical, and electromechanical commodities.
- Experience supporting new product introduction (NPI), prototype builds, engineering validation, and production ramp activities.
- Strong understanding of procurement execution, supplier delivery management, material planning, inventory control principles, and ERP/MRP workflows.
- Experience working with enterprise resource planning (ERP) and material requirements planning (MRP) systems (Windchill, MISys, NetSuite, SAP, Oracle, etc.).
- Demonstrated ability to improve procurement processes, establish operational metrics, and drive execution excellence.
- Strong leadership, communication, stakeholder management, and problem-solving skills.
- Experience developing high-performing procurement teams through coaching, mentorship, and performance management.
- Ability to build strong cross-functional relationships while driving accountability, operational discipline, and continuous improvement.
